The Cyclohexane Market grew from USD 27.86 billion in 2024 to USD 29.38 billion in 2025. It is expected to continue growing at a CAGR of 5.42%, reaching USD 42.51 billion by 2032.

Comprehensive Overview of Cyclohexane Market Dynamics and Product Applications Driving Value Across Multiple Chemical Industry Segments

Cyclohexane serves as a cornerstone of the chemical industry, underpinning the production of pivotal intermediates such as adipic acid and caprolactam that feed into nylon and polyamide manufacturing. Its versatile solvent properties drive demand in paints, coatings, adhesives, and sealants, while specialized grades support pharmaceutical synthesis and laboratory applications. In recent years, the interplay between feedstock availability, feedstock cost volatility, and downstream requirements has underscored the importance of resilient supply chains and innovative process technologies.

Moreover, the expanding automotive, construction, and textile sectors have sustained steady demand for nylon fibers and engineering plastics derived from cyclohexane intermediates. At the same time, heightened regulatory scrutiny on volatile organic compounds has propelled investments in cleaner production pathways and solvent recovery systems. Emerging Technological Innovations and Sustainability Initiatives Reshaping Cyclohexane Production Processes and Supply Chain Efficiency Globally

The cyclohexane industry is witnessing transformative change as manufacturers adopt advanced catalysts and electrified hydrogenation processes to enhance energy efficiency and reduce greenhouse gas emissions. Innovative heterogeneous catalysts with extended lifetimes are enabling process intensification, allowing producers to achieve higher conversion rates at lower temperatures and pressures. Simultaneously, digital twins and real-time analytics are being embedded in plant operations to optimize throughput, minimize downtime, and sharpen responsiveness to feedstock price swings.

Concurrently, stakeholders are piloting bio-based and circular feedstocks, such as cyclohexanol derived from biomass or recycling waste polyamide streams, to address sustainability mandates and differentiate product credentials. These initiatives are supported by collaborations among technology licensors, engineering firms, and end users aiming to decarbonize upstream operations. As regulatory landscapes tighten and end-use industries prioritize environmental performance, these innovations are reshaping traditional production paradigms and unlocking new value streams across the cyclohexane value chain.

Detailed Analysis of Cyclohexane Market Segmentation Insights Across Application Grade End User and Distribution Channels Informing Strategic Planning

A nuanced segmentation analysis reveals distinct growth drivers and risk factors across cyclohexane applications, grades, end users, and distribution channels. Within the adhesives and sealants domain, pressure-sensitive products demand high-purity cyclohexane to ensure optimal bonding performance, while sealants incorporate tailored solvent blends for construction and automotive seal integrity. In the chemical intermediate space, adipic acid production benefits from feedstock consistency, whereas caprolactam and cyclohexanone pathways prioritize impurity control to meet polymerization and resin standards. The solvent segment bifurcates into cleaning agents requiring stringent safety approvals and paints and coatings formulations where evaporation profiles influence curing times and finish quality.

When assessing grade differentiation, industrial grade cyclohexane dominates commodity applications, while laboratory grade supports specialized research and development activities that probe new chemistries. Demand drivers among end users further diverge: agrochemical producers leverage cyclohexane for pesticide and fertilizer component synthesis, chemical manufacturers incorporate it into polymer, rubber, and specialty chemical lines, and coatings and adhesives makers calibrate solvent properties to optimize product stability and compliance. Pharmaceutical manufacturers rely on high-purity streams for active pharmaceutical ingredient and drug formulation processes. From a distribution standpoint, direct sales foster strategic collaborations between large producers and major end users, regional and wholesale distributors ensure widespread market coverage, and online channels via company websites and e-commerce platforms enhance accessibility for niche and small-batch purchasers. By integrating these four segmentation lenses, stakeholders gain clarity on demand hotspots, margin levers, and collaboration opportunities across the cyclohexane landscape.

In-Depth Regional Analysis of Cyclohexane Market Evolution and Opportunities Spanning Americas Europe Middle East Africa and Asia Pacific Landscapes

Regional assessments underscore a complex interplay between capacity, demand growth, and regulatory environments. In the Americas, robust downstream manufacturing facilities in the United States and Canada have leveraged integrated refining assets to optimize cyclohexane supply, while Latin American markets are gradually scaling up production to serve domestic agrochemical and coatings industries. Innovations in solvent recovery and emissions control technologies have been particularly prominent, responding to stringent environmental standards.

Europe, the Middle East and Africa exhibit a tapestry of mature markets in Western Europe, rapidly expanding petrochemical hubs in the Gulf Cooperation Council region, and emerging demand centers in Africa. Regulatory frameworks around volatile organic compounds and circular economy principles have spurred investments in green production pathways and collaborative research consortia. Localized feedstock access, particularly in natural gas-rich countries, has underpinned cost-competitive output.

In the Asia Pacific, powerhouse economies such as China, India and South Korea continue to drive the fastest growth rates, buoyed by expanding automotive, electronics, and textile sectors. Government incentives for advanced chemical parks, combined with rising environmental mandates, are fostering the development of next-generation hydrogenation units and solvent capture systems. Across all regions, diversifying sourcing strategies and forging strategic partnerships remain critical for stakeholders seeking to navigate dynamic regional landscapes.
